The fact that all alternatives (save I) appear in both
branches is a very bad start. The branches in a nested
logit model cannot overlap. There is a stray comma in
branch AA. Your model is not identified; one of the parameter
pairs in branch AA must be normalized at zero. I would
replaace the ;MODEL:... part of the command with
;RH2=one,X
The tree is something else. I guess you should just
discard branch BB.

Dear all,
I am trying to run the following model ;
Nlogit
; LHS = Choice, Cset, Altij
; Choices = A, B, C, D, E, F, G, H, I
; Tree = AA(A,,B, C, D, E, F, G, H), BB(A, B, C, D, E, F, G, H), CC(I)
; Start = Logit
; Show
; Model :
U(A) = B10+B11*X/
U(B) = B20+B21*X/
U(C) = B30+B31*X/
U(D) = B40+B41*X/
U(E) = B50+B51*X/
U(F) = B60+B61*X/
U(G) = B70+B71*X/
U(H) = B80+B41*X/
U(I) = B90 [0]
;Ivset : (CC) = [1.0]
;Maxit=150
;Utility = U1 $
(All X are individual specific variables and are constant over
different choice).
I get the following error message:
Error 1020: The model is too complex - too many parts. Table overflow.
I could not find this error message in LIMDEP Reference Guide 9.0.
Can someone explain what does this error means or what is wrong here ?
